The Supreme Soviet of the Republic of Azerbaijan, being guided by the higher state interests of the people of Azerbaijan and expressing its will, noticing that within date from 1918 to 1920 the Republic of Azerbaijan existed as independent state recognized by international community, being based on the Constitution of the Republic of Azerbaijan, the Constitutional laws on sovereignty of the Republic of Azerbaijan and about bases of economic independence of the Republic of Azerbaijan, realizing the responsibility for destiny and maintenance of free development of the people of Azerbaijan,

guaranteeing the rights provided by the international acts and the basic freedom of a person to all citizens of the Republic of Azerbaijan irrespective of a national identity and religion, aspiring to prevent threat to the sovereignty and territorial integrity of the Republic of Azerbaijan, being guided by a holy duty to provide safety and inviolability of national boundary of the Republic of Azerbaijan, realizing necessity of consolidation of all patriotic forces of republic,

recognizing the international pacts, conventions and other documents which are not contradicting to interests of the Republic of Azerbaijan and its people, wishing to support and henceforth friendly relations with all republics of USSR,

expressing readiness to establish equal relations with the states – members of international community,

hoping for a recognition of the state independence of the Republic of Azerbaijan by member states of the international community and the United Nations Organization according to the principles fixed in the Charter of the United Nations Organization and other international legal pacts and conventions,

Proclaims the restoration of the state independence of the Republic of Azerbaijan.

The Declaration is accepted on August 30, 1991 at special session of the Supreme Soviet of the Republic of Azerbaijan
